Pretty soon your mobile phone will also be able to moonlight as your mobile wallet. Thats right, AT&T, Verizon, and T-Mobile have teamed up to create a new mobile commerce network, calling it ISIS. It will work by using near-field communication technology with short-range, high-frequency wireless technology to enable the encrypted exchange of information between devices at a short distance. The tri-network venture has a customer-base of over 200 million and expects to launch in “key geographic markets” in the next 18 months; Facebook has announced a new unified messaging system that provides users with e-mail. Users will also have the ability to communicate with one another on the Web and on mobile phones regardless of whether they are using e-mail, text messaging, or online chat services. Data protectionism : Serfing the web
A small spat highlights a big issue: who owns your online identity?
SUCH is Facebook’s attraction these days that even Britain’s monarch has finally joined the 500m-plus users of the online social network. On November 8th Queen Elizabeth II launched a Facebook page to publicise the royal family’s doings. Within a day, it had attracted almost 200,000 “likes” from around the world plus messages such as “Hello Liz xxx”. But it had also turned into a forum for an acrimonious slanging match between supporters of the monarchy and its critics.
Buckingham Palace says that the Queen’s e-mail address, if she has one, is secret. But it will not end in gmail.com. That will spare her from another wrangle—a kind of digital trade war. On November 5th Google introduced a technical change that blocks its e-mail users from automatically transferring their electronic address book in one lump when they set up a Facebook account. It is part of Google’s efforts to defend its dominance of the internet from Facebook’s growing challenge (as is Google’s announcement this week giving all its 23,000 employees a 10% pay rise and a $1,000 bonus, which is an attempt to halt defections to Facebook). …

MAS won’t intervene on SGD at current level: Source
Singapore MAS comfortable with recent rise in local dollar vs US dollar, won’t intervene near current USD/SGD levels, source familiar with central bank thinking says.
Also, MAS likely to stand pat at next policy review in October.
“The rise hasn’t been dramatic and at current levels the Singapore dollar is competitive for our exports,” source says, adding MAS unlikely to intervene unless USD/SGD falls “clearly and sustainably closer to $1.34.”
Pair last 1.3629 vs 1.3625 Friday close.

Paedophilia and the Catholic church: Evil orders
The growing scandal about child abuse reaches the top of the Vatican
A SUBTLY disquieting photograph greets visitors to the website of the northern Italian diocese of Bozen-Brixen. The dark recesses of a sunken passageway end in a flight of steps leading to daylight. A click leads to an e-mail address for reporting sexual or physical abuse by priests. The first person to use it spoke anonymously to the newspaper Corriere della Sera. As a wartime evacuee, he recalled how a village curate “felt my trousers, tried to kiss me and asked me to caress him”. His younger brother told him the priest was still molesting boys 13 years later.
The web initiative has recently been praised as an exercise in openness and may be extended to other parts of Italy. Yet the e-mail address had long been on the site, and came to prominence only amid the mushrooming worldwide scandal involving hundreds of people molested by priests or in church-run institutions. …

Google Wave Pushes AppJet to Sell Out to Google
Google purchased real-time document collaboration startup AppJet to fortify the Google Wave real-time collaboration platform Dec. 4. The move was a sell out from a company that felt it couldn’t compete with the sheer scope of Wave and Google, Y Combinator partner Paul Graham said. Now EtherPad is no longer accepting new customers and anyone who have registered an e-mail address with EtherPad will be e-mailed an invitation to join the Google Wave preview by December 31, 2009. EtherPad users are angry and Graham’s explanation of why AppJet quit is unlikely to appease them.
